I know you want want to reset your email password but are you at present able to log onto your email account?
If you are you can reset the password by logging onto your account using a web browser then clicking on your user name at the right hand side then going to "account info" then "Change Password" and then follow the prompts.
If you are asked security questions the answers are the ones that were given by the BT Broadband account holder who set up the email account, unless you were "gifted" the email account and set up your own MyBT in order to manage the account in which case it will be the answers to the security questions you set.
